Berman Gets Bid to Run in K. of C. Track Tournament

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

Ronald S. Berman '52, top middle-distance man on the varsity track team, will compete in the Pront Invitation 600-yard run in the Knights of Columbus meet, it was announced yesterday. The tourney is scheduled for the Boston Garden January 20.

Berman, who is also anchorman on the varsity's mile relay squad, is the first Crimson runner in over a decade to be asked to compete in an invitation event.
